如何关闭服务器的CORS功能
时间: 2024-04-21 17:29:45 浏览: 205
从WFS服务器添加功能1
CORS(跨域资源共享)是一种浏览器安全机制,用于限制不同域之间的资源共享。如果你想关闭服务器的CORS功能,具体的做法取决于你使用的服务器软件和框架。
以下是一些常见的服务器软件和框架的关闭CORS功能的方法:
- Apache:在Apache的配置文件中添加以下代码:
Header always set Access-Control-Allow-Origin "*"
Header always set Access-Control-Allow-Methods "POST, GET, OPTIONS, DELETE, PUT"
Header always set Access-Control-Allow-Headers "Authorization, X-Requested-With, Content-Type, Accept"
- Nginx:在Nginx的配置文件中添加以下代码:
add_header 'Access-Control-Allow-Origin' '*';
add_header 'Access-Control-Allow-Credentials' 'true';
add_header 'Access-Control-Allow-Methods' 'GET, POST, PUT, DELETE, OPTIONS';
add_header 'Access-Control-Allow-Headers' 'DNT,User-Agent,X-Requested-With,If-Modified-Since,Cache-Control,Content-Type,Range,Authorization';
- Node.js:使用CORS中间件,具体做法如下:
const express = require('express');
const cors = require('cors');
const app = express();
// 允许所有来源访问
app.use(cors());
如果你使用的是其他的服务器软件或框架,可以参考其官方文档或者在网上搜索相关资料来了解如何关闭CORS功能。
阅读全文